These are the output voltages of an original archos power supply:
|
||||||
|
- connected to AJB Recorder, not charging: 13,7 Volt
|
||||||
|
- connected to AJB Recorder, charging: going down to 10,4 Volt
|
||||||
|
|
||||||
|
Here is how changing the input voltage changes the charging current:
|
||||||
|
|
||||||
|
voltage charging current (limited only by the AJB)
|
||||||
|
------------------------------------------------------
|
||||||
|
7,0V 10 mA
|
||||||
|
7,5V 30 mA
|
||||||
|
8,0V 50 mA
|
||||||
|
8,5V 70 mA
|
||||||
|
9,0V 140 mA
|
||||||
|
9,5V 250 mA
|
||||||
|
10,0V 330 mA
|
||||||
|
10,5V 350 mA
|
||||||
|
11,0V 350 mA
|
||||||
|
11,5V 350 mA
|
||||||
|
12,0V 350 mA
|
||||||
|
|
||||||
|
To summarize:
|
||||||
|
|
||||||
|
- do not use an input voltage > 12V
|
||||||
|
- optimal input voltage is 10V (regulated)
|
||||||
|
- use a fuse of ~600mA
|
||||||
|
- using a different charger voids your warrenty
